Featured dishes

View full menu
DARK ALE AND MOLASSES BRISKET
12-hour slow cooked, grass fed brisket with dark ale and molasses BBQ sauce, ranch slaw, dill pickles and salad
SOUTHERN FRIED BUTTERMILK CHICKEN
Fried free range buttermilk marinated chicken with ranch slaw salad
HAITIAN PORK BELLY
Slow cooked citrus and spice marinated free range pork belly served with pickliz, green plantain and salad
KENTUCKY FRIED TOFU
Marinated tofu coated in our Kentucky spiced maize flour with vegan ranch slaw and homemade chipotle ketchup

Interesting decor... most i can't post pictures of because of t&c. It's very... different to say the least. Bar staff are excellent, very friendly and professional. I ordered some "chicken bites", southern fried buttermilk chicken with spicy mayo. The spice from the mayo apparently all found it's way into the chicken bites... they were hot! Awesomely spicy and delicious. Would have been a little better paired with a cooler mayo, but still an excellent accompaniment to a pot of beer. The decision to make a giant mirror into a urinal in the men's bathroom is slightly questionable, but doesn't exceed the questionable architectural decisions I've seen in some other pubs. Clientele were a mixed lot, the place seems popular with a variety of crowds. Of all the venues in the cbd it easily rates in the top half. Free wifi and free water makes it obvious that the bottom end is placing customer service and comfort above the bottom line.. Table tennis table, pinnies and board games gives the venue a very sociable feel. Smoking area out the front, no food there (as per smoking regulations) but drinks can be taken out (during normal service at least). Happy hour at the moment is mon-fri 4-7pm. $15 jugs and $1 sriracha wings makes this a great option for after work drinks.

My favourite pub in Melbourne 🍻 It ain’t posh, but its got great music, fun staff, rock vibes, big booths and plenty of weird and wonderful stuff on the walls. It’s L.A meets Australia - 90’s grungy booths and neon lights but full of energy. Pints of Monteith’s cider on tap for $12 and plenty of greasy American diner goodies on the menu. The staff make the place. Great vibes.
